Confirel Gains International Recognition in Vienna
Confirel earned international recognition in June 2025 during a trip to Vienna, Austria, receiving the Newcomer Award 2025 at Free From Specialty, Europe's premier expo for allergen-free and specialty food products -- recognition of the company's work on quality, sustainability and innovation in Cambodian agriculture.
The Vienna expo gave Confirel a platform to introduce Cambodian agricultural products to European trade buyers, who showed strong interest in the company's certified products and environmentally responsible practices. During the awards ceremony, a Confirel representative presented a copy of founder Dr Hay Ly Eang's memoir to event organisers, marking more than two decades of the company's work.
Confirel representatives also met with partners at UNIDO's headquarters to discuss ongoing collaboration, focusing on the company's agricultural modernisation approach and its potential relevance for other developing economies. UNIDO counterparts noted particular interest in Confirel's methodical approach to long-standing challenges in agriculture -- certification costs, access to financing, environmental resilience, market data and technology adoption.
